Newtrace: Driving India's Green Hydrogen Revolution
Key Ideas
  • India's National Green Hydrogen Mission aims to produce 5 Mn metric tonnes of green hydrogen annually by 2030, aligning with the global trend towards reducing CO2 emissions.
  • Bengaluru-based cleantech startup Newtrace is revolutionizing the hydrogen market with its cost-effective electrolyser technology, positioning itself as a key player in India's domestic and export markets.
  • Newtrace's innovative electrolyser technology has garnered investor attention, with successful funding rounds and collaborations, showcasing a promising future for the startup.
  • With a focus on applications in the oil and gas industry and plans for commercial deployment with major players like ONGC Energy Center, Newtrace is on track to lead India's green hydrogen revolution.
Green hydrogen, produced using renewable energy sources, is gaining momentum globally, including in India where the National Green Hydrogen Mission targets significant production by 2030 to combat climate change. Bengaluru's Newtrace, founded in 2021, has developed cutting-edge electrolyser technology for green hydrogen at reduced costs. The startup's journey, from inception to partnership with major corporations like BPCL and ONGC Energy Center, reflects its commitment to revolutionizing the hydrogen market. Newtrace's technology stack, featuring innovative versions of electrolysers, is well-received in industries such as oil, gas, and steel, driving its success. With substantial funding and government support, Newtrace is poised to play a crucial role in India's green hydrogen ecosystem and beyond.
